Identification of Suspect Sought in Snow Blower Caper
  

In early December 2009, a male suspect phoned Classic Honda at 20 Van Kirk Drive in Brampton to purchase a snow blower and used a stolen Visa card number.

 

The suspect then attended a few days later and picked up the snow blower using a truck similar to the one pictured below.   The Visa card was never shown, and never left the victim’s possession. The suspect presented a fraudulent driver’s license in the card holder’s name,    pictured below.  

 

Suspect Description:  Male, white, mid 20’s, black hair, Eastern European accent

Suspect Vehicle:  24 foot cube truck – white with blue stripe around the box
